Discover the Benefits of Cutting-Edge Custom Software Features for Your Business

Nov 7, 2023

Custom software offers a range of features and solutions that can benefit businesses of all sizes.

Custom software can be a game changer for businesses of all sizes, providing unique solutions tailored specifically to their needs. It is a development process in which a software application is created to meet the specific requirements of a particular organization. As a result, the customer has ultimate control over the design, functionality, and features of the software.

Investing in custom software offers numerous benefits that can give your business a competitive edge. It may seem like a significant expense, but the long-term benefits often outweigh the initial cost. In fact, many forward-thinking companies are turning to custom software to stay ahead of their competitors in today's rapidly evolving digital landscape. So why should your business consider investing in custom software? Let's take a closer look.

I. Introduction

A. Definition of Custom Software

Custom software is a tailor-made software solution designed to address the unique needs and requirements of a particular organization. It is a highly specialized process that involves collaboration between the software development team and the client to develop a product that meets their specific needs. Unlike off-the-shelf software, custom software is built from scratch and can be modified as the organization's needs evolve.

B. Benefits of Investing in Custom Software

- Custom software offers a solution that is specifically designed for your business, which means it can improve efficiency and productivity.
- It is customizable and can be modified as your business grows and evolves.
- It can save time and money in the long run by streamlining processes and reducing the need for multiple software solutions.
- Custom software can give you a competitive edge by providing unique features and functionalities that are not available in off-the-shelf software.
- It guarantees a high level of security, as it is built to meet the specific security needs of your organization.

II. Examples of Custom Software Features

There are various features of custom software that can benefit businesses in different ways. Let's explore some of the features that can take your business to the next level.

A. Features for Internal Use

Custom software can be used to streamline internal processes and make them more efficient. For example, if your business requires extensive data analysis, custom software can be designed to simplify the process and provide accurate and comprehensive reports in real-time. The software can also have automated features that save time and reduce the risk of human error.

B. Features Meant to Enhance User Experiences

In today's highly competitive business landscape, the user experience is critical. Custom software allows businesses to develop applications that are intuitive and user-friendly, resulting in a positive user experience. By providing a seamless and intuitive user experience, businesses can increase customer satisfaction and loyalty, leading to improved customer retention and increased revenue.

C. Features Intended to Improve Workflows

Custom software can provide solutions to specific business challenges, such as workflow inefficiencies. For example, a custom CRM (customer relationship management) system can be developed to automate customer interactions and improve customer service response times. This results in streamlined and efficient processes, leading to increased productivity and improved customer satisfaction.

III. Factors to Consider when Purchasing Custom Software

A. Establish a Clear Set of Requirements

The success of custom software development relies heavily on clear communication between the client and the development team. It is crucial to establish a set of requirements that outline the desired features and functionalities of the software. This helps in the development process and ensures that the final product meets the specific needs of your organization.

B. Perform a Cost Analysis

Custom software may seem like a significant expense upfront, but it is essential to consider the long-term benefits. It is crucial to perform a cost analysis to determine the return on investment (ROI) and the potential savings from utilizing the software over time. This will help you make an informed decision when investing in custom software.

C. Ensure the Developer is Experienced and Qualified

The success of custom software development depends largely on the skills and expertise of the software development team. It is essential to choose a developer who has experience in developing custom software and has a good understanding of your business and its needs. Look for case studies, reviews, and references to assess their capabilities and ensure that you are working with the right team.

IV. Challenges Faced by Companies Acquiring Custom Software

As with any significant investment, there are challenges that businesses may encounter when investing in custom software. Let's take a look at some of the common challenges and how to address them.

A. Identifying the Right Developer

Finding the right developer can be a daunting task, especially if you are not familiar with the software development process. It is essential to do thorough research, ask for referrals, and review their previous work to ensure that you are working with a reputable and competent developer.

B. Understanding the Ongoing Costs

When investing in custom software, it is crucial to understand that the initial cost is not the only expense. Ongoing maintenance and updates may be necessary to ensure that the software remains effective and useful to your business. It is essential to discuss any potential ongoing costs with the developer before entering into an agreement.

C. Addressing Security Concerns

Custom software is often perceived as less secure than off-the-shelf software because it is not as widely used. However, this is not necessarily the case. Custom software can be designed with tight security measures in place to protect your organization's sensitive data. It is crucial to discuss security concerns with the developer to ensure that the final product meets your security requirements.

V. Conclusion

A. Custom Software Investment Can Pay Off

While investing in custom software may seem like a significant expense, the long-term benefits often outweigh the initial cost. Custom software can provide unique solutions tailored to your organization's needs, resulting in increased efficiency, productivity, and a competitive edge.

B. Consider the Benefits and Challenges Carefully

It is essential to carefully consider your business's specific needs and the potential benefits and challenges associated with custom software before making an investment. Conduct thorough research, establish clear requirements, and choose a reputable and experienced developer to ensure the success of your custom software project.

In conclusion, custom software offers a range of features and solutions that can benefit businesses of all sizes. It is essential to weigh the benefits and challenges carefully and choose the right developer to ensure that you are making a sound investment for your business's future. With the rapidly evolving digital landscape, investing in cutting-edge custom software features can give your business the competitive edge it needs to thrive.